Special Consideration for Teachers
- National teachers and State Universities and Colleges (SUC) faculty receive an additional two-step increase (approx. 10%) on top of the general two-step increase, totaling a four-step increase or approx. 20%
- Local teachers' salaries and COLAs adjusted to match national teachers after increases
Cost-of-Living Allowance (COLA)
- Additional COLA based on adjusted salaries:
- P150/month for salary level P2,500 and below
- P50/month for salary range P2,501 to P3,000
- Exclusions from COLA:
- Employees of GOCCs
- Employees already receiving other cash emoluments apart from standard pay and allowances
Equalization for Excluded Agencies
- Employees in excluded agencies whose total compensation falls below counterparts in covered agencies shall receive increases to equalize compensation but not exceeding the maximum amounts under the order
Funding Sources
- National Government personnel salary increases funded from:
- Salary lapses and personal services savings within ministries/agencies
- Lump sum appropriations for salary increases within agency budgets
- Funds re-aligned from less/non-essential activities and programs
- Salary Adjustment Fund under the 1986 General Appropriations Act
- Local teacher salary and COLA adjustments charged to internal revenue allotments and local government funds
- Local governments authorized to grant the two-step salary increase and COLA subject to available funds and joint commission rules
Ministry of Budget and Management (MBM) Responsibilities
- To study, review, upgrade, and revise compensation for CESO and equivalent/higher positions ensuring adequacy and competitiveness
- To formulate and issue implementing rules and regulations for the Order
Effective Date
- The Order takes effect July 1, 1986
